关于数据中附件字段如何设置,如何提取字段的数据。

在处理数据时,附件字段是一种常见的数据类型,它可以存储各种类型的文件,如文档、图片、音频等,设置和提取附件字段的数据需要使用特定的方法和工具。

我们需要了解如何设置附件字段,在大多数数据库管理系统中,可以通过创建一个新的字段来设置附件字段,这个字段的类型通常被设置为BLOB(Binary Large OBject),这是一种可以存储二进制数据的字段类型,在创建字段时,我们还需要指定字段的最大长度,这取决于我们要存储的文件的大小,如果我们要存储的是图片文件,那么可能需要将最大长度设置为几MB或更大。

关于数据中附件字段如何设置,如何提取字段的数据。

设置好附件字段后,我们就可以开始存储文件了,这通常需要使用数据库管理系统提供的API或命令,如果我们使用的是MySQL数据库,那么我们可以使用INSERT语句来插入一个文件,这个语句的格式如下:

INSERT INTO table_name (field_name) VALUES (LOAD_FILE(\'file_path\'));

在这个语句中,table_name是我们要插入文件的表的名称,field_name是我们刚刚创建的附件字段的名称,file_path是我们要插入的文件的路径,执行这个语句后,文件就会被存储到数据库中。

我们可以使用SELECT语句来提取附件字段的数据,这个语句的格式如下:

SELECT field_name FROM table_name;

在这个语句中,table_name是我们要提取数据的表的名称,field_name是我们刚刚创建的附件字段的名称,执行这个语句后,我们就可以得到附件字段的数据了,这些数据通常是二进制格式的,我们需要使用适当的工具来解析它们,如果我们要解析的是图片文件,那么我们可以使用图像处理软件来打开它;如果我们要解析的是文档文件,那么我们可以使用文本编辑器来查看它。

设置和提取附件字段的数据是一个相对复杂的过程,需要对数据库管理系统有一定的了解,只要我们掌握了基本的方法,就可以轻松地完成这个任务。

相关问题与解答

1. 问题:我可以使用哪些数据库管理系统来存储附件?

几乎所有的数据库管理系统都支持存储附件,包括MySQL、Oracle、SQL Server、PostgreSQL等,不同的数据库管理系统可能提供了不同的API或命令来操作附件,但基本的存储和提取方法都是相同的。

2. 问题:我可以将任何类型的文件作为附件吗?

理论上,你可以将任何类型的文件作为附件,你需要确保你的数据库管理系统和应用程序能够正确地解析和显示这些文件,如果你尝试将一个视频文件作为附件存储,但是你的应用程序只能显示文本文件,那么你可能无法正确地查看这个视频文件。

3. 问题:我可以在多个表中存储同一个附件吗?

是的,你可以在多个表中存储同一个附件,你只需要为每个表创建一个附件字段,然后将附件插入到这些字段中即可,这样做可能会导致数据冗余和一致性问题,因此你需要谨慎考虑是否真的需要这样做。

4. 问题:我可以在附件字段中存储大型文件吗?

这取决于你的数据库管理系统和硬件的性能,附件字段的大小是有限制的,如果你尝试存储一个超过这个限制的文件,那么你可能会遇到错误,如果你需要存储大型文件,那么你可能需要使用其他的解决方案,如云存储服务。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/459526.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
硬件大师硬件大师订阅用户
上一篇 2024年6月28日 17:47
下一篇 2024年6月28日 17:47

相关推荐

  • 教你租个香港服务器。

    租用香港服务器,享受高速稳定网络连接和优质数据服务。 租用香港服务器搭建小说网站,需要选择适合的配置,以下是一些常见的配置建议: 1、服务器硬件配置:选择一台高性能的服务器,如 Intel Xeon 处理器、DDR4 …

    2024年7月16日
    00
  • 经验分享天津网络公司大全。

    一、天津网络公司简介 随着互联网的快速发展,越来越多的企业开始涉足网络领域,天津作为我国北方的重要城市,网络公司也随之崛起,本文将为您介绍一些天津的网络公司,以及天津今晚网络公司的待遇情况。 二、天津…

    2024年6月16日
    00
  • 如何启动mongodb的服务器。

    启动MongoDB服务器需要先安装MongoDB,然后通过命令行输入mongod即可。 MongoDB是一个开源的NoSQL数据库,它使用BSON(类似于JSON)格式存储数据,MongoDB提供了丰富的查询和索引功能,可以快速地处理大量的数据,…

    2024年7月14日
    00
  • 我来教你深入浅出Oracle中的物理表。

    Oracle中的物理表是指存储在磁盘上的数据库对象,由数据块组成,包含行和列,用于持久化存储数据。物理表结构由段、区、盘区构成,支持索引以加速查询。 深入浅出Oracle中的物理表 在Oracle数据库中,物理表是存储…

    2024年6月26日
    00
  • 小编分享如何在 Windows 上快速查看 MongoDB 数据库的方法。

    MongoDB简介 MongoDB 是一个开源的 NoSQL 数据库,属于文档型数据库,它以键值对(key-value)的形式存储数据,具有高性能、高可用性、易扩展等特点,在 Windows 系统上,我们可以使用 MongoDB Compass 或者命令行工…

    2024年7月3日
    00
  • 聊聊数据中心:数字化时代基石,探索科技繁荣之路。

    随着科技的飞速发展,数据中心已经成为数字化时代的重要基石,它们为全球各地的人们提供了高速、稳定的网络连接,使得信息传播和资源共享变得轻而易举,本文将详细介绍数据中心的概念、技术特点以及未来发展趋势,…

    2024年7月24日
    00
  • 教你如何安装redis数据库。

    Redis-dump 是一个用于备份和还原 Redis 数据库的工具,以下是如何安装 redis-dump 的详细步骤: 1、检查系统环境 在开始之前,确保你的系统满足以下条件: 安装了 Redis。 安装了 Node.js,redis-dump 是一个 Node…

    2024年7月14日
    00
  • 说说html如何获取数据库的信息。

    HTML本身并不能直接获取数据库的信息,需要通过服务器端的编程语言(如PHP、Python、Java等)来连接数据库并获取数据,然后将数据传递给HTML页面进行展示,以下是使用PHP和MySQL数据库的示例: (图片来源网络,侵…

    2024年6月26日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息